SUMMARY

 

In May 2019, the City Council approved a referral requesting that staff meet with the City’s various non-sworn bargaining groups to explore the option of exchanging a recognized holiday for the observance of Cesar Chavez’s birthday (March 31).  As an alternative to adding an additional holiday, staff recommends enacting a business closure in observance of Cesar Chavez’s birthday.  Similar to the current holiday business closures, employees can either work, take time off using accrued leave, or take time off without pay during this business closure day.  The business closure does not impact essential services such as Police and Fire, Communications (dispatch), and the Water Pollution Control Facility.  

 

The day of the proposed business closure would mirror Hayward Unified School District’s observance of the holiday, which is the Monday closest to Cesar Chavez’s birthday.  For calendar year 2020, Cesar Chavez’s birthday falls on Tuesday, March 31.  The proposed business closure would be Monday, March 30.
